The Indian telecommunications sector has undergone a dramatic transformation over the past decade, with once-dominant public sector players like Bharat Sanchar Nigam Ltd (BSNL) and Mahanagar Telephone Nigam Ltd (MTNL) steadily losing ground to private powerhouses such as Bharti Airtel and Reliance Jio. These private entities aggressively leveraged cutting-edge foreign technology alongside disruptive pricing strategies, effectively leaving state-run telecom companies scrambling to stay relevant. In response, BSNL and MTNL have embarked on a bold strategic shift focused on deploying indigenous 4G and 5G technologies—marking not just a technological upgrade, but a deeper commitment to India’s Atmanirbhar Bharat (self-reliant India) vision. This initiative offers a significant exploration into the interplay between national interests, global tech trends, and market realities, raising questions about the viability and impact of such a home-grown revival in a fiercely competitive arena.
The decision by BSNL and MTNL to transition toward an indigenous 4G-5G stack is more than a mere technological facelift; it represents a strategic maneuver aimed at reclaiming relevance and autonomy in the telecom marketplace. Historically, these public sector undertakings played foundational roles in establishing India’s telecommunication infrastructure. However, the entry of Reliance Jio, with its aggressive pricing policies supported by modern, foreign technology, catalyzed a shift in consumer preference that eroded BSNL and MTNL’s market share. Facing a duopoly dominated by Jio and Airtel, the public operators recognized that survival would depend not only on matching technological advancements but also on reducing dependency on foreign vendors—a vulnerability starkly highlighted amid ongoing geopolitical tensions. Embracing indigenous technology thus serves dual purposes: it aligns with national policies aimed at self-reliance, and it situates the telecom giants to better control their supply chain, security, and cost structures.
One of the foremost advantages of adopting an indigenous 4G-5G technology stack lies in enhancing technological sovereignty while also enabling greater cost control. Developing home-grown network infrastructure allows BSNL and MTNL to tailor their solutions specifically to India’s nuanced requirements, from spectrum management to cybersecurity considerations, circumventing the constraints frequently imposed by external technology suppliers. Reports indicate that BSNL has already successfully deployed over 80,000 4G sites nationwide using this indigenous tech, forming a scalable backbone that can be upgraded smoothly to 5G. Such a phased rollout strategy not only ensures operational stability but also reflects an understanding of pragmatic execution; stabilizing 4G operations before plunging into full-scale 5G deployment ensures network reliability and customer confidence. This approach also positions BSNL and MTNL to maintain agility, adapt to technological updates, and align rollout schedules with consumer demand and infrastructure readiness.
Supporting this domestic technological pivot is a robust policy framework championed by the Indian government. Communications Ministry officials have explicitly confirmed that BSNL’s 5G infrastructure deployment will exclude foreign technology, underscoring an unequivocal commitment to the Atmanirbhar Bharat initiative. This policy stance creates an enabling ecosystem for indigenous telecom equipment manufacturers and fosters increased investment in research and development within India—key drivers for nurturing a sustainable domestic telecom industry. Additionally, reducing reliance on imported technology mitigates risks associated with global supply chain disruptions, which have become more pronounced in light of geopolitical tensions and international trade uncertainties. The government’s backing thus transforms what might have been a commercial strategy into a strategic national directive, intertwining economic security with technological innovation.
Nevertheless, the path to revival is fraught with significant challenges. Competing against private operators armed with cutting-edge global technology and supported by deep pockets requires more than just indigenization of tech stacks. BSNL and MTNL must also excel in network rollout efficiency, offer competitive pricing, elevate customer service quality, and adopt sound asset management practices to carve out market share. Notably, BSNL’s re-evaluation of asset sales, such as keeping ownership of telecom towers rather than selling them off, underscores the recognition that infrastructure ownership is critical for rapid deployment and seamless upgrading to 5G. The technology in place must match or exceed consumer expectations in terms of data throughput, network reliability, and voice clarity—all potent factors influencing customer retention. This comprehensive operational focus signals a strategic awareness that technology alone will not reverse fortunes without a supporting framework of execution excellence.
Integrating indigenous 4G and 5G technology into the existing telecom infrastructure also demands a high degree of technical robustness and performance reliability. The growing data consumption rates and soaring expectations of seamless connectivity place a high bar on new network deployments. BSNL’s staggered rollout strategy, starting with stabilizing 4G services before moving to full-fledged 5G implementation, embodies a cautious but realistic roadmap that balances ambition with infrastructure and market readiness. Furthermore, the in-house development and testing of 5G core networks in key strategic locations like Chanakyapuri and Nehru Place signal tangible progress from conceptual development to operational feasibility. Such trials are crucial for refining the technology, troubleshooting potential challenges, and building consumer confidence in the indigenous technology’s performance.
